Output cfc623925fb758a20fd41020671a8716e06b463cff51bda14f28d87f49e93304:1

value
667616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ec6e9c45100c5906b26754cf512ec4406e07806 OP_EQUAL
address
3Qv9qzmMijSiBfNn5Mia2YKcmWePXxHExW
transaction
cfc623925fb758a20fd41020671a8716e06b463cff51bda14f28d87f49e93304
spent
true